Belongs within: Astereae.

Erigeron, the fleabane daisies, is a cosmopolitan genus of herbs and subshrubs with generally radiate heads, often borne in loose clusters (Hickman 1993).

Characters (from Hickman 1993): Annual to perennial (subshrub). Stems generally erect. Leaves alternate, generally entire. Inflorescence with heads generally radiate, one to many in loose, panicle-like or flat-topped clusters; involucre hemispheric; phyllaries narrowly lanceolate, in two to several equal to strongly graded series; receptacle flat to steeply conic, naked, smooth to shallowly pitted. Ray florets, if present, generally ten to many; ligules generally white, pink, or blue (rarely yellow). Disk florets many; corollas generally narrow funnel-shaped, yellow; style tips 0.1–0.8 mm, more or less triangular. Fruit 0.5–3 mm, generally more or less oblong, compressed to more or less cylindric, generally two-ribbed, generally sparsely hairy; pappus, if present, generally of 6–50 longer inner bristles and shorter outer bristles, narrow scales, or short crown.
